Invoke Activity (Preview)
It looks like they have started graying out (with "legacy" tittle) Invoke Pipline activity (existing/old) and it's new version is available to use (still in preview though).
I see there are three options Fabric, ADF and Synapse. It also need connection for each option. Does that mean if I've ADF created in Azure and I would be able to invoke its pipelines directly from Fabric?

Yes, the “Invoke Activity” activity allows you to invoke a pipeline from different services, including Fabric, Azure Data Factory (ADF), and Synapse.
Each of these options requires a connection to be established, and if you have set up the necessary connections, you can call ADF pipelines directly from the fabric.
